What's the difference between remediation and restoration after smoke damage?

Remediation is the initial process of containment and removal of damage sources to prevent further harm. Restoration is the subsequent phase of repairing and rebuilding to return your property to its pre-fire condition. Our smoke damage cleaning in Greenville addresses both critical stages.

What does smoke damage cleaning involve?

Smoke damage cleaning involves specialized techniques for removing soot, deep cleaning all affected surfaces, and employing advanced deodorization methods to eliminate lingering odors.
